Pan Asia Bank records Impressive Performance amidst Challenges – Profit after Tax soars by 50% to post Rs. 1,356 Mn
August, 3, 2021
Pan Asia Banking Corporation PLC reported an impressive performance for the six-month period which ended 30 June to report a Pre-Tax Profit of Rs. 1,822 million and a Post-Tax Profit of Rs. 1,356 million with growth rates of 27% and 50% respectively, while demonstrating the resilience amidst challenging macro-economic conditions.
The bank’s performance was characterised by strength and resilience despite the heightened uncertainty due to the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ic.
